    Some clarification of terminology might help in the discussion of double and secondary bevels.  

    In wood carving lingo a tool with a "double bevel" has a bevel on both sides of the tool, as with most caver's chisels.  A single beveled tool  has the bevel on one side of the tool, as with a carpernter's chisel--which gives it a self-jigging function (follows a straight wall along the unbeveled side).  And, of course,  most gouges are single beveled tools.

    A "secondary bevel" is the term used for the short bevel near the tip,  located  on  the same side of the tool  that is already beveled.
